Mark Text version 0.19.0 has been released, offering users a versatile cross-platform markdown editor that excels in note-taking, real-time previewing, and formatting of markdown code. This application is designed to cater to a variety of tasks, including creating plain text documents, web pages, and other formats, with the capability to easily export files to HTML or PDF.
The interface of Mark Text is intentionally clutter-free, aiming to provide a distraction-free writing experience reminiscent of Notepad, but with enhanced functionality tailored for specific tasks. Users can customize aspects of the editor, such as switching to a dark theme or selecting different view types from drop-down menus. A standout feature is the focus mode, which emphasizes the current paragraph, helping users maintain concentration while writing.
Mark Text also supports various markdown features, making it a powerful tool for users who require advanced formatting options. Some notable features include:
- Table Block Support: Users can easily manage tables with the ability to add or remove rows and columns.
- Diagram Support: The editor can create flowcharts, sequence diagrams, Gantt charts, and Vega charts, enhancing visual representation of information.
- Inline Formats: It supports CommonMark and GitHub Flavored Markdown specifications, ensuring compatibility with widely used markdown formats.
- Math Formula Support: Users can include mathematical expressions using markdown extensions like KaTeX.
- Code Block Support: It allows for GFM code fences and syntax highlighting through prismjs.
